Official recalls

1

98V016000 · Electrical System:starter Assembly

Jan 27, 1998

VEHICLE DESCRIPTION: PASSENGER VEHICLES. DUE TO IMPROPER ASSEMBLY OF THE TERMINAL FOR THE STARTER MOTOR MAGNETIC SWITCH, AN ELECTRICAL SHORT CIRCUIT CAN OCCUR IF ELECTRICALLY-CONDUCTIVE LIQUID, SUCH AS ROAD SPLASH WITH DEICING SALT, ENTERS THIS AREA.

Consequence & remedy

Consequence: A STARTER MOTOR NO-START CONDITION OR AN UNDERHOOD FIRE CAN RESULT.

Remedy: DEALERS WILL REPAIR THE MAGNETIC SWITCH.
